Структура LDAPMessage (winldap.h)
Структура LDAPMessage используется функцией LDAP для возврата результатов и данных об ошибках.
Синтаксис
typedef struct ldapmsg {
ULONG lm_msgid;
ULONG lm_msgtype;
PVOID lm_ber;
struct ldapmsg *lm_chain;
struct ldapmsg *lm_next;
ULONG lm_time;
PLDAP Connection;
PVOID Request;
ULONG lm_returncode;
USHORT lm_referral;
BOOLEAN lm_chased;
BOOLEAN lm_eom;
BOOLEAN ConnectionReferenced;
} LDAPMessage, *PLDAPMessage;
Члены
lm_msgid
lm_msgtype
lm_ber
lm_chain
lm_next
lm_time
Connection
Request
lm_returncode
lm_referral
lm_chased
lm_eom
ConnectionReferenced
Комментарии
Структура LDAPMessage — это непрозрачный тип данных, возвращаемый сервером при вызове функции поиска или обхода. Например, после выполнения асинхронной операции можно вызвать ldap_result , чтобы получить ответ LDAPMessage сервера. Другим примером является вызов ldap_search_s, который также возвращает ldapMessage.
Чтобы освободить структуру LDAPMessage , когда она больше не требуется, вызовите ldap_msgfree.
В этой структуре нет доступных для клиента полей.
Требования
Минимальная версия клиента | Windows Vista |
Минимальная версия сервера | Windows Server 2008 |
Верхняя часть | winldap.h |